"Broadband" request has been rejected

Hi, 

 

I have been using the Sky broadband for two years. Just recently/suddenly I have found that thay 2 of my mobile phones are not getting connected to the wifi with correct wifi passcode and they show the message "SKY....request has been rejected". My other two devices laptop and other mobile phone are ok. I have tried the followong things but neither worked:

 

1) Set forget network and tried to reconect with passcode

2) Reset mobile network setting

@Hasan7 Sky want you to use their online tools before calling them so numbers only appear after you reaxh the end of a help journey. If you have a phone connected to the Sky Talk line which comes with everySky  Broadband connection dial 150 for a free call.

 

First point is double check you are not misreading the passcode as Sky use both the numbers 1 & 0 as well as the letters I,l and O and its easy to misread them. If you are not as well as telling the phonectonforger the connection power them down fully and then reboot them as that clears the memory location used to store WiFi passcodes completely.
